November 7, “Loose Plate” will go for the Tools
of Hope which includes the Blanket Ministry. Like the Holy family two
thousand years ago, more than 35 million people today need a safe place to lay
their head. That is why helping to meet the need for shelter is a major part of
the Church World Service Tools of Hope & Blanket Program. From tents, blankets, and other emergency
supplies for survivors of the earthquake that devastated Bam, Iran, to
emergency food rations, blankets, candles and matches and plastic sheeting in
the wake of monsoon flooding in parts of India, shelter needs come in all
shapes and sizes. We can help these people with our “Loose Plate” offering.
A warm blanket costs just $5 but can make a big difference between
health and sickness.
